ENGINE UNIT


  1. CONSTRUCTION


    1. The chain sub-assembly uses a 9.525 mm (0.375 in.) pitch high-strength roller chain, and the No. 2 chain sub-assembly uses a 8.000 mm (0.315 in.) pitch high-strength roller chain, reducing friction.

    2. Resin is used for the chain slipper and chain damper, reducing friction and increasing abrasion resistance.

    3. A timing chain guide is provided between the intake camshaft and exhaust camshaft to suppress vibrations in the chain sub-assembly and improve quietness and to achieve reliability. Also, resin is used for the sliding portion of the chain, in consideration of abrasion resistance.

    4. The chain tensioner uses the spring and oil pressure to always maintain appropriate tension in the chain sub-assembly and No. 2 chain sub-assembly, ensuring quietness and reliability. Also, the chain tensioner uses an internal oil retention mechanism and a ratchet mechanism to improve quietness when starting the engine and low engine rotation.

    5. A chain tensioner gasket is used to improve oil retention, improving quietness when starting the engine.
